COMMUNITY COLLEGE ROUNDUP : OCC Women Finish Third, Men Fifth in Cross-Country Meet

The Orange Coast College women’s cross-country team finished third and the men placed fifth Friday at the MiraCosta Invitational at Vista Park.
El Camino won the women’s event with 46 points. Mt. San Antonio (63) was second and OCC scored 94 points. Mari Genavides of OCC was fourth overall with a time of 19 minutes 54 seconds on the 5,000-meter course. Sherri Fox (20:51) of OCC was 12th.
El Camino also won the men’s title with 66 points, Mt. San Antonio was second with 68 and Glendale was third with 77. OCC had 179 points. Jose Brito finished 10th overall with a time of 21:32 on the four-mile course.
In nonconference women’s volleyball:
Orange Coast 3, El Camino 0--Nikki Lemerise had 11 kills, six blocks and five aces and Reiko Matsumoto had 14 kills to lead host Orange Coast (1-1) to a 15-13, 15-6, 15-12 sweep.
In the Cuesta water polo tournament:
Saddleback 11, Cerritos 10--Jason Armison scored with two seconds left to lift Saddleback. Cerritos led, 10-8, with 2:06 left but Saddleback scored the final three goals. Omar Ward had three goals for Saddleback (2-2), which lost to Cuesta, 16-4, earlier in the day.
